More than 3000 years ago, the heart of Tuscany was home to the Etruscan civilization, a people noted for their culture and wine…
Today Tuscany is home to the Tolaini Estate, a winery that combines these ancient elements with modern winemaking. At the heart of Tolaini’s practice is sustainable farming that respects the environment and the biodiversity of the land.
Pier Luigi Tolaini is the founder and visionary of the winery. A 4-year search for a top Tuscan vineyard brought Pier Luigi to the prestigious region of Castelnuovo Berardenga, and the properties at Montebello
and San Giovanni. When Pier Luigi first set foot on the amphitheatre-shaped vineyard at Montebello, he knew he had found the perfect balance of climate, soil, and exposure
“The 2012 Valdisanti is based on Cabernet Sauvignon, with Sangiovese and Cabernet Franc in supporting roles. This is a beautiful expression with a full and generous disposition. The wine opens to a dark garnet color and thick consistency. You very much taste the Cabernet in this vintage, with dark fruit aromas backed by savoury spice and smoke. This wine shows slight tertiary aromas as well that add to the background complexity and texture.” Monica Larner ~ October 31st, 2017
